# [A Framework for Benchmarking Clustering Algorithms](https://clustering-benchmarks.gagolewski.com)
## Benchmark Suite Version 1 (with updates)

The aim of this project is to **aggregate, polish, and standardise the
existing clustering benchmark batteries** referred to across the machine
learning and data mining literature, and to introduce **new datasets**
of different dimensionalities, sizes, and cluster types.

This repository is part of the
[**Framework for Benchmarking Clustering Algorithms**](https://clustering-benchmarks.gagolewski.com).
It hosts the datasets from version 1 of the benchmark suite.

## Changelog

The datasets and the reference labels included in this suite
are versioned. This ensures reproducibility.

See for
downloadable snapshots.

### 1.1.0 (2022-09-17)

- Each battery is now equipped with a README.txt file.

- New label vectors:
wut/x2.labels1,
wut/x3.labels1.

- Prettified (slightly) label vectors:
graves/fuzzyx.labels[1-4],
graves/parabolic.labels1.

- Deleted now redundant label vectors:
graves/fuzzyx.labels5.

- The historical snapshot of this release is available at
DOI: [10.5281/zenodo.7088171](https://doi.org/10.5281/zenodo.7088171).

### 1.0.1 (2022-09-10)

- Updated dataset description files, e.g., fixed broken links.

- The code and the data repositories were separated; see
and
.

- The project's homepage has been created. It is available at
.

- The historical snapshot of this release is available at
DOI: [10.5281/zenodo.7066690](https://doi.org/10.5281/zenodo.7066690).

### 1.0.0 (2020-05-08)

- Datasets in the 1st (v1.0.0) version of the benchmark
battery are now frozen.

- The historical snapshot of this release is available at
DOI: [10.5281/zenodo.3815066](https://doi.org/10.5281/zenodo.3815066).

### 0.0.0 (2015-12-29)

- Version 0 of the benchmark suite consists of the datasets
studied in: Gagolewski M., Bartoszuk M., Cena A.,
Genie: A new, fast, and outlier-resistant hierarchical
clustering algorithm, *Information Sciences* **363**, 2016, pp. 8–23,
DOI: [10.1016/j.ins.2016.05.003](https://doi.org/10.1016/j.ins.2016.05.003).
